Marguerita is a qualified engineer with over 15 years of experience in design, construction, site supervision, building physics, and sustainability. She qualified as a Low Carbon Consultant and Low Carbon Energy Assessor with CIBSE in 2009, advising architects and engineers in low-energy and low-carbon solutions for buildings, producing thermal, daylight, general environmental, and energy reports utilizing various industry-approved simulation packages.

In 2017 Marguerita was part of a team as co-author of the new overheating guidance for houses, CIBSE’s TM59 Design methodology for the assessment of overheating risk in homes. Dynamic, determined, self-motivated individual with good communication and team-work skills.

Marguerita is passionate about her work and believes passive design solutions and a holistic approach are the keys to energy-efficient buildings and truly sustainable projects.
